Quick Review: Top Factors of SEO

This is just a quick post to help us remind the factors that affect the ranking of our website or blog in search engines. In making a blog, always be reminded of the positive and negative factors in SEO.



Top Five Positive Factors
  1. Keyword Use in Title Tag
  2. Global Link Popularity of Site
  3. Anchor Text of Inbound Link
  4. Link Popularity within the Site
  5. Age of Site
Top Five Negative Factors
  1. Server is Often Inaccessible to Bots
  2. Content Very Similar or Duplicate of Existing Content on the Index
  3. External Links to Low Quality/Spam sites
  4. Participation in Link Schemes or Actively Selling Links
  5. Duplicate Title/Meta Tags on Many Pages

Get More Traffic Using Google Images

As what I've discussed in some of my posts, getting traffic for your website or blog is one of the main goal in achieving a high revenues. You can do this by using Google Image Search, which is a tool to easily find images in the net by using phrases or keywords just like an ordinary web search.
A lot of people are using Google Image Search for a varied purposes, whether it is entertainment or pictures of cars.
Highly relevant images shows up at the top of Google Image Search which sends the owner of the site a great deal of traffic. And if you as a blogger can be on that list then it would be pretty good for you.

Google Images Search Optimization is much alike with the basic search optimization such as relevant keywords to the content and title. But Image Search Optimization has its own unique factors that affect the ranking of these images. Listed below is a list of tips on how you optimize your images for better traffic.

  • Use keywords in your 'alt' text
    This is the basic of all image optimization tricks. You should always insert a phrase or a keyword in the alt text of the image. But always be sure that it is relevant to the content of the site. Example: <img src="file.jpg" alt="alt description here" >
  • Use anchor text keywords in links to images
    When you have an image that has a link, let's say for example an image of harry potter which links to a full view of the picture itself that say's "click here to see full view". The phrase itself is general and doesn't help in optimization, instead use "Harry Potter in Azkaban" or "Harry Potter Photo".
  • Use descriptive titles in naming images
    If you have an image of Optimus Prime dancing that has a filename of "Image0012.jpg" rename it to something like "Optimus-Prime-dancing.jpg" or "Optimus-dances.jpg". You can also rename the file that is the same with your alt text.
  • Widen the categories of your images
    When you broaden the categories of your images it gives you more traffic. For example you have a blog which is all about Naruto, use other images like anime's that are alike with Naruto or any other anime that relates to Naruto. In this way the incoming traffic would probably be looking for some anime images. Remember, more traffic means more money.
  • Use relevant texts or phrases around the image
    Take into consideration the texts around the image. Be sure to have a description of over 20+ characters below the image and make the text in bold.

A race for the first page of Google™ (with tips on how-to)

Being a top rank in Google is always the goal for every website especially for bloggers. But why? Other than the popularity itself, more traffic means more money making opportunity for your blog. But how can someone reach the top? Are there any tricks to it? How do you get a high rank using only Blogger?

One way of ranking higher in google or any other search engine is by using your title wisely. Search engines like google reads the title from left to right to weigh its popularity. So basically, every post you make should have different titles with your blog title to the right. In this manner, when someone searches a keyword on the net and matches up with your blog post title then there is a great tendency that your blog post will be the top result.

Blogger doesn't have this kind of functionality which means you are not fully utilizing your blog to rank higher. But you can tweak your blog to do this. Follow these three easy steps and you'll be on your way to popularity and becoming rich.

  1. Access your layout tab then go to Edit HTML

    a

  2. Search for the string below in the template code. (ctrl + F for windows)
    <title><data:blog.pageTitle/></title>
  3. Replace the code with the following code. And Save your template
    <b:if cond='data:blog.pageType == &quot;index&quot;'>
    <title><data:blog.title/></title>
    <b:else/>
    <title><data:blog.pageName/> | <data:blog.title/></title>
    </b:if>

Let’s get back to our main topic, search engines aren’t usually manned they are actually automated or programmed which we call web crawlers or spiders. These web crawlers follow an algorithm in which they search through the net using keywords and such. And you can’t just make a site where you don’t follow the things that these web crawlers are looking for; you need guidelines to do this. Here are some basic guidelines for your site to be noticed by these web crawlers:

  • Always use of <h1>. Add <h1> tags to some keywords
  • Add relevant keywords and page or site description to your meta tag
  • Always use the keywords mentioned in your meta tag
  • Use SEO friendly URLs like
  • http://google.com/about instead of
  • http://google.com/index.php?page=1
  • If you have a flash content on your website then make a html copy of it
  • Make use of tags in images
  • You should have a sitemap for your site
